Consultant Psychiatrist in CAMHS – Hartlepool

Closing date: 20 March 2026

This is an exciting opportunity for a child and adolescent consultant psychiatrist to become involved in transformation and leadership within a forward‑looking CAMHS service at Tees, Esk and Wear Valleys NHS Foundation Trust. The role offers the chance to shape the service and support professional growth.

Durham Tees Valley Child and Adolescent Mental Health Services work with children and young people up to 18 across a range of teams, including neurodevelopmental assessments and specialist services. The service is supported by a 24/7 crisis team and home‑treatment options.

The Getting More Help team is based at Dover House, Hartlepool, with good transport links and free car parking for staff.


Main duties

The post holder will offer mental‑health assessment, psychiatric opinion, diagnosis and holistic care plans for patients to 18. The Trust expects about two new patient assessments per week, with face‑to‑face contacts totaling approximately 650 per year. Clinical work will be conducted mainly at Dover House, with the possibility of community settings such as schools.

The post holder must be Section 12 approved, preferably with Approved Clinician status. The Trust will support securing these approvals if not already in place.

Clinical supervision of at least eight hours per year is required, delivered either face‑to‑face or remotely via secure MS Teams.


About the Trust

Tees, Esk and Wear Valleys NHS Foundation Trust is one of the largest specialist mental health and learning disability trusts in the country, with an annual income of £320 m and a workforce of over 6 700 staff. The Trust provides inpatient and community services to over 2 m people across the region and works in partnership with local authorities, CCGs, voluntary organisations and service users.

Person specification


Leadership

* Reflects on own performance and behaviour, seeks and acts on feedback.
* Influences and persuades to improve services, takes on a leadership role in multidisciplinary team.
* Shows commitment to quality through knowledge of quality improvement and lean thinking methodology.


Academic Skills & Lifelong Learning

* Delivers undergraduate or postgraduate teaching and training.
* Participates in continuous professional development, research or service evaluation.
* Uses clinical evidence and has actively participated in clinical audit.


Qualifications

* MB BS or equivalent medical qualification.
* Fully registered with the GMC with a licence to practise at the time of appointment.
* Qualification or higher degree in medical education, clinical research or management.
* MRCPsych or equivalent postgraduate qualification.
* Approved Clinician Status and Section 12 Status, or able to achieve within three months.


Clinical Knowledge & Skills

* Excellent knowledge in specialty and clinical skills using a bio‑psycho‑social perspective.
* Wide medical knowledge, excellent oral and written communication skills.
* Manages clinical complexity and uncertainty and meets duties under MHA and MCA.
